The TA043 is an active differential probe suitable for high common-mode voltage measurement applications up to ±700 V (DC + peak AC). It can be used with signal speeds of up to 100 MHz.
This differential probe extends the functionality of standard single-ended input oscilloscopes to allow a safe and accurate method of making high-voltage differential measurements. Applications include making safe measurements in power circuit applications and acquisition of low-speed balanced differential signals found in serial communications buses.
